Common Factors for Emergency Situation Dental Sees



In emergencies, you may find yourself seeking an emergency dental practitioner as a result of extreme tooth pain or a sudden injury to your mouth. Tooth pain can be severe, varying from sharp, stabbing sensations to consistent throbbing. This pain might suggest an underlying concern such as an abscess, split tooth, or infection that requires immediate attention from a dental specialist.

Tips to Take When Dealing With an Oral Emergency



When dealing with an oral emergency situation, keep in mind to continue to be calm and evaluate the circumstance very carefully prior to taking any kind of activity. The very first step is to assess the seriousness of the problem. Is it causing extreme discomfort, bleeding, or swelling? If so, it's essential to look for immediate help. Call your emergency dentist or go to the nearest emergency room if the scenario is severe.

While waiting on professional aid, there are some actions you can require to handle the emergency. If you have a knocked-out tooth, try to position it back in its socket without touching the root or store it in milk up until you can see the dental practitioner.

For a tooth pain, rinse your mouth with warm saltwater and usage over the counter pain medicine if needed. Avoid applying aspirin directly to the affected location, as this can create burns to the gum tissues.

Crucial Things to Bring to Your Emergency Dental Practitioner Visit



Review what items you ought to bring to your emergency dentist appointment to ensure a smooth and efficient browse through.

Primarily, do not fail to remember to bring your identification and insurance coverage details. These files are necessary for the management process and ensuring you get the appropriate treatment.

In addition, bear in mind to load any medicine you're presently taking, as well as a listing of allergic reactions or clinical conditions that the emergency dental practitioner ought to understand.
